The highest waves of the December 1992 storm coincided with high tide. Do you think that the damage during the storm would have been any different if the highest waves had occurred during low tide? Explain your answer
What will be an ideal response?
When the tide is high, waves break closer to shore and erode more sediment than when the tide is low. It is possible that the damage resulting from wave erosion would have been less if the storm had peaked during low tide instead of high tide.
